Resumo: We develop a theoretical model which explains the joint decision for joining a telephone network and using it. We arrive at testable propositions and use data for the Portuguese telephone services to test them. Results suggest that positive network externalities are very important. A 10% increase in the network would increase the demand for access by 7-8% in the long run and an increase in traffic by 6-7% in the long run (assuming constant population). The income elasticity for traffic is greater than one in the long run. Both these results imply a strong pressure in the telephone network and a need for planning so that the quality of the services does not deteriorate.
